John Charles Maimone, 85, of Eustis, FL, passed away leaving behind a legacy of love, laughter, and a commitment to his community.
A graduate of the Palmer School of Chiropractic in 1964, John dedicated 35 years of his life to helping others as a local chiropractor. His passion for wellness and healing extended far beyond his office walls as he touched countless lives through his care and compassion.
John was also a pillar of his community, serving as a Past Member and Past President of the Eustis Rotary Club, where his leadership reflected his love for service. He was a proud member of the Elks Club, devoted to bringing people together and strengthening bonds within Eustis.
He is lovingly remembered by his wife of 42 years, Loretta Maimone, and is survived by his daughter, Carolyn Maimone, and son, Shawn Clark. John also cherished his two grandchildren, Nicole Maimone and Stetson Clark, as well as his great-grandchild, Coty Mae Clark. John was pre-deceased by his son, Gregory Maimone.
But John’s life was so much more than his achievements. Known for his quick wit and infectious sense of humor, he had a unique way of making everyone around him smile. An aficionado of restoration, John spent countless hours breathing new life into antique cars, transforming them into timeless treasures. His love for adventure was just as strong—whether riding motorcycles or taking trips to the scenic mountains of North Carolina with his friends, he was always chasing freedom and the open road.
John’s life was defined by his dedication to his family, friends, and the community he cherished so dearly. His warmth, humor, and zest for life will be deeply missed but will live on in the stories and memories shared by those who had the honor of knowing him.
